Transaction 5e575477f25c72ada967d58fc8813de224ac938e6e1cda2eeab943f4594c03e4

2 Input
1 Outputs
  • 5e575477f25c72ada967d58fc8813de224ac938e6e1cda2eeab943f4594c03e4:0
  • value  2433880
    address  3C3wyZ1wzDH3ror1qaqe6ZmCMNMGD4YsLt